Output 18596c7973f72f23f85bb04e957cf712300c4d2d9ac418272e1f387fdc330824:53

value
4585953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6559b260fab8c3b376afcbda474359f2f0ccf3b0 OP_EQUAL
address
3AvudAHuD1CqYHNnmaaYVj9xL6RLWmm7Jy
transaction
18596c7973f72f23f85bb04e957cf712300c4d2d9ac418272e1f387fdc330824
spent
true